Technology Strategy Without Hiring a Full-Time CTO

A Virtual Chief Technology Officer (vCTO) provides executive level technology leadership on a flexible basis. Instead of hiring a full time CTO, organizations gain experienced guidance for technology planning, infrastructure decisions, and long term digital strategy.

Many businesses grow faster than their technology strategy evolves. Systems expand, vendors multiply, and infrastructure decisions become harder to manage. A vCTO helps bring structure to those decisions while aligning technology investments with business priorities.

vCTO Overview

What a vCTO Does for Your Business

A vCTO provides executive level technology leadership without the need to hire a full time CTO. This role focuses on planning, decision making, and long term direction rather than daily support. By building a clear roadmap and guiding key technology choices, a vCTO helps your business stay aligned as systems grow more complex.

This includes evaluating platforms, improving infrastructure, and aligning technology with business goals. Instead of reacting to issues as they arise, your team gains a structured approach that supports steady progress and better outcomes over time.

A vCTO, or Virtual Chief Technology Officer, provides strategic technology leadership as a service. Instead of hiring a full time executive, your business gains guidance for planning, infrastructure decisions, and long term strategy.

Businesses often turn to vCTO services when technology decisions become more complex or when internal teams focus mainly on daily support. Growth, system changes, or new initiatives can create a need for clearer direction and long term planning.

An MSP focuses on day to day IT support such as help desk services, maintenance, and monitoring. A vCTO focuses on strategy, planning, and guiding long term technology decisions, often working alongside an MSP to provide direction.

A vCTO typically focuses on technology strategy, systems, and innovation, while a CIO often focuses more on internal IT operations and business processes. A vCTO offers similar leadership in a flexible model without requiring a full time role.

A vCTO helps evaluate cloud platforms, plan migrations, and guide how new systems are adopted across your organization. This ensures changes align with business goals and are implemented without disrupting daily operations.

A vCTO helps ensure security is considered in technology decisions by aligning systems with best practices and supporting risk awareness. For deeper security needs, a vCISO typically leads the program while the vCTO supports overall alignment.

Look for a provider with strong experience in infrastructure, cloud platforms, and vendor management, along with the ability to align technology decisions with business goals. Clear communication and the ability to scale with your needs are also important.

A vCTO works alongside your internal team rather than replacing it. Your staff handles daily support while the vCTO focuses on planning, architecture, and guiding major initiatives.
